Grinchmas back at Universal Studios Hollywood

Universal Studios

The Grinch arrived back in Hollywood today for Universal Studios’ Christmas extravaganza.

Grinchmas runs at weekends until December 15 and then daily from December 20-31 and is included in the theme park admission.

“Whobilation” throughout the park features The Grinch and his faithful dog Max, a lively performance at the original “Who-ville” movie sets aboard the world famous Studio Tour and a soaring “Grinchmas” tree at the heart of the spectacular Universal Plaza.

The Universal Plaza, an elaborate grand piazza at the heart of the park, is the new venue for the towering “Grinchmas” tree – a whimsical centrepiece twisting and spiralling 60 feet above visitors. On the behind-the-scenes Studio Tour, fans of the blockbuster film, “Dr. Seuss’ “How the Grinch Stole Christmas,” can enjoy a close-up view of the original Who-ville film sets with a one-of-a-kind performance by a Who’s Who of Who-ville re-enacting memorable scenes and songs from the family favourite.
